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 9 -- United States Patent no. 12,288,319, issued on April 29, was assigned to CURRENT LIGHTING SOLUTIONS LLC (Beachwood, Ohio).
"Commissioning of indoor positioning system aided by augmented reality" was invented by Glenn Howard Kuenzler (East Cleveland, Ohio) and Taylor Apolonius Barto (East Cleveland, Ohio).
